生成的热力图怎么导出表格
-
在生成热力图后,如果需要将热力图中的数据导出为表格形式(例如Excel表格),可以按照以下步骤进行操作:
-
导出数据点坐标:首先,可以将生成热力图所使用的数据点坐标导出为表格。对于每个数据点,表格中通常包括其横坐标、纵坐标以及对应的数值。这些坐标和数值数据可以帮助我们重新绘制热力图或进行进一步的数据分析。
-
导出热力值数据:如果热力图中显示的是每个数据点的热力值(如密度、温度等),可以将这些热力值数据导出为表格。在表格中,每行对应一个数据点,列可以包括数据点的坐标以及对应的热力值。这样的表格可以用于后续的统计分析或可视化。
-
导出颜色数值映射表:热力图中的颜色通常表示数据点的数值大小,不同颜色对应不同的数值范围。可以将颜色和对应数值的映射关系导出为表格,这样可以清晰地了解每种颜色所代表的数据范围,方便进一步解读热力图。
-
导出表格数据为CSV文件:一种常见的方法是将上述数据导出为CSV(逗号分隔值)文件格式。CSV文件可以方便地在各种数据分析软件中进行导入和处理。在导出数据时,可以指定表格的字段分隔符、文本限定符等参数,以确保数据的准确性和完整性。
-
利用数据可视化工具导出表格:有些数据可视化工具(如Python中的matplotlib、R语言中的ggplot2等)提供了直接将图表数据导出为表格的功能。通过这些工具,可以快速将热力图中的数据导出为Excel、CSV等格式的表格,便于进一步分析和应用。
通过以上步骤,我们可以将生成的热力图中的数据导出为表格,以便后续分析和应用。
1年前 -
-
生成的热力图通常是基于数据集进行分析和可视化后得出的结果。如果您想将热力图中的数据导出到表格中,可以根据不同的工具和软件进行操作。以下是常见工具中导出热力图数据到表格的方法:
- 使用Python的seaborn库:如果您是使用Python中的seaborn库生成热力图,可以将热力图中的数据导出为DataFrame对象,然后通过DataFrame的to_csv()方法将数据保存为CSV文件,或者直接将数据复制粘贴到Excel表格中。
import seaborn as sns import pandas as pd # 生成热力图 data =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6], 'C': [7, 8, 9]}) sns.heatmap(data) # 导出数据到CSV文件 data.to_csv('heatmap_data.csv', index=False)-
使用Excel:有些可视化软件或工具可以直接在Excel中生成热力图。您可以通过编辑图表或导出数据的功能将热力图中的数据导出为表格。
-
使用可视化工具:一些在线可视化工具,如Tableau、Power BI等,生成的热力图可以直接与数据关联,通过工具内置的导出数据功能将数据导出到表格中。
请根据您使用的具体工具或软件,选择最适合的方法来导出热力图中的数据到表格中。如果您有更详细的问题或需要针对特定工具的操作方法,请提供更多信息,我将尽力为您提供帮助。
1年前 -
生成热力图并导出表格
1. 生成热力图
首先,我们需要用适当的工具生成热力图。通常,我们可以使用Python中的Matplotlib库或者其他可视化库来生成热力图。在生成热力图的过程中,我们需要确保数据格式正确,包括行列标题,以及热力值。
以下是一个使用Matplotlib库生成热力图的简单示例:
import matplotlib.pyplot as plt import numpy as np data = np.random.rand(10, 10) # 生成随机数据作为示例 plt.imshow(data, cmap='hot', interpolation='nearest') plt.colorbar() plt.show()2. 导出热力图数据
要将热力图导出为表格,我们可以通过以下步骤将热力图数据保存到Excel或CSV文件中。
2.1 安装 pandas 库
首先,确保你已经安装了pandas库。如果没有安装,你可以使用以下命令来安装:
pip install pandas2.2 导出热力图数据
在生成热力图的同时,我们需要将相应的数据保存为一个Pandas DataFrame对象,以便后续导出。接着,我们可以将DataFrame保存为Excel或CSV文件。
以下是一个示例代码,演示如何将热力图数据保存到CSV文件:
import pandas as pd import numpy as np # 生成随机数据并创建DataFrame data = np.random.rand(10, 10) df = pd.DataFrame(data) # 将DataFrame保存为CSV文件 df.to_csv('heatmap_data.csv', index=False)通过上述步骤,我们成功将热力图数据保存为CSV文件。您可以根据需求选择保存为Excel文件或其他格式。
总结
通过以上步骤,你可以生成热力图并将其数据导出为表格。记住,在实际应用过程中,你可能需要根据具体的数据格式和需求做一些调整和修改。希望这些信息对你有所帮助!
1年前